Greater white-toothed shrew vs Mountain Water Rat
Crocidura russula compared with Baiyankamys habbema
Key Differences
- Greater white-toothed shrew is Least Concern while Mountain Water Rat is Data Deficient.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Greater white-toothed shrew | Mountain Water Rat |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(प्राणी) | Animalia (प्राणी)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(रज्जुकी) | Chordata (रज्जुकी) |
| Class same | Mammalia (स्तनधारी) | Mammalia (स्तनधारी) |
| Order | Soricomorpha (Soricomorpha) | Rodentia (कृंतक) |
| Family | Soricidae | Muridae (Mice & Rats) |
| Genus | Crocidura | Baiyankamys |
| Species | Crocidura russula | Baiyankamys habbema |
Evolutionary Relationship
Greater white-toothed shrew and Mountain Water Rat share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(स्तनधारी)
